Amy emailed me looking for ideas for a blue and pink baby shower. Though she already has inspiration ready for an upcoming shower I am happy to add to that with a few ideas of my own.- Add a small floral centerpiece and light blue rimmed china to a blush pink tablecloth for a beautiful and sophisticated table setting.
- A simple favor consists of a light blue box topped with a pink slip of paper that can denote the guest's name. Make the scroll element by wrapping the paper around a pencil. - Pink invitations with blue text and a damask-patterned blue envelope liner [via]

This month's Birthday Dinner post features the color pewter. Combined with touches of gold, pewter creates an old-world glamour feel to this party theme.- Miscellaneous pewter and gold desserts put together on a tray provides color-coordinated options for your guests (via Matthew Mead)- Use an array of vintage pewter trays for serving food. Consider utilizing them in your centerpiece too or try pewter vases for floral arrangements (via Matthew Mead)- A golden favor box adorned with a piece of pewter rhinestone jewelry (via Matthew Mead)- A vintage-inspired chiffon silk dress for the guest of honor- Pewter and gold colored dinnerware add to a lovely table setting- Pewter candelabra with gold candles creates an old-world glow at the center of your table

Winter weddings are the perfect time to take advantage of one of the most elegant and lovely colors - white. Subtle and sophisticated, classic and chic, this color is stunning when used solo or when paired with other winter hues. Consider steel blue, black, periwinkle, silver, sage green or, as in today's inspiration board, pewter.- Italian-influenced designs adorn this stunning white and pewter wedding cake- Reception table with white florals, linens, dinnerware, candles and seating- Bridesmaids in white dresses, pair with pewter-toned jewelry and heels- A white floral bouquet is accented with crystals and pewter brunia tie into the pewter ribbon belt on the bride's dress- A boutonniere made of a single ranunculous and a silvery dusty miller branch- A homemade favor of snow-white vanilla meringues
